Compared with superphosphate manufacture, the production of dicalcium phosphate for fertilizer purposes, by the conventional method of dissolving phosphate rock in hydrochloric acid and precipitating the phosphate with milk-oflime, is uneconomical of reagent materials.

In the production of dicalcium phosphate, it has been necessary to exert particular care in order that tricalcium phosphate be not produced. The tricalcium phosphate is objectionable because of its extreme fineness which makes filtration difficult and also because it is partially unavailable for fertilizer purposes.

A method of producing dicalcium phosphate from calcium phosphate includes reacting the calcium phosphate with a mineral acid such as sulphuric acid to produce a calcium salt and phosphoric acid. The calcium salt may then be hydrolyzed to form a calcium alkali which may then be reacted with the phosphoric acid to produce dicalcium phosphate.

Dicalcium phosphate is a crystalline feed grade Dicalcium phosphate containing 19.0% Minimum phosphorous and 28.0% Maximum calcium. The selected raw material of non-animal origin and the production process ensures an end product with good phosphorous digestibility and a content of undesirable elements well below that stipulated by EU feed legislation.

This invention relates to the preparation of feed grade dicalcium phosphate from a source containing monocalcium phosphate such as super phosphate, concentrated super phosphate and the like. The first step consists of leaching water soluble mono calcium phosphate therefrom with water or recycle wash water from one of the subsequent steps.
